DescriptionThis area is sunny until about 1PM. It can be windy and is usually crowded on weekends and in the afternoons in the summer. Rock quality is excellent. Getting ThereAfter you hike up the trail, this is the first wall you come to. It is extremely featured for the first 20 feet or so.
